Transaction 1cc2464017ffb9fab48dc83ac4055dce099601e87927021e6520aeb278f32b2e
1 Input
1 Output
-
1cc2464017ffb9fab48dc83ac4055dce099601e87927021e6520aeb278f32b2e:0
- value
- 18601497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1b387fef89b45920752fa92b022bef775013938 OP_EQUAL
- address
- 3NGR2kiCPAZAfto89BXDqX6q3fvfwrbKzJ